New Bus for Bierley Community Association
Bierley Community Association runs The Life Centre, a community centre in the heart of Bierley housing estate in Bradford. The facility has been the beating heart of the community for many years and provides multiple services to residents including benefits advice, counselling and exercise for the over 60s.
They received funding to purchase a community minibus to help them reach isolated older people, disengaged young people and families. The minibus has been a great success with the centre reporting a big increase in service users now that accessible transport is available. The group gave us a breakdown of how the bus has been used so far:
82 Exercise Classes
72 Friday Friends - Crafts / games / trips
42 Bingo sessions
19 Cover to Cover Book club
22 Senior council meetings
71 Asda Shopping Bus
64 Home Visits
2 Christmas Meals
3 Cinema trips
The bus is utilised 7 days a week by the community association and other charitable groups in the area including The Vine, St Christopher’s and Bierley Bethel.
